Streamlined Integration and Connectivity


Installation of this voltmeter is simplified through its two-wire connection method: a red wire for the positive (+) terminal and a black wire for the negative (-) terminal. The visual documentation clearly illustrates this straightforward wiring scheme. Furthermore, the unit incorporates detachable lead wires, enhancing flexibility during installation and potential maintenance. The specified wire length is 19cm.

The simplicity of a two-wire connection significantly reduces installation complexity, making this device accessible even for individuals with fundamental electrical knowledge. Detachable leads offer practical advantages, such as easier wire routing through tight spaces or simplified replacement if the leads become damaged. Wiring is uncomplicated.

Unlike more sophisticated multi-wire meters that might necessitate external power sources or dedicated shunt resistors, this self-powered design streamlines integration into existing DC circuits. The inclusion of reverse connection protection is a notable user-friendly enhancement, mitigating the risk of damage from common wiring errors, a frequent frustration with less forgiving electrical components.

Operational Reliability and Safeguards


The voltmeter's 4-100V DC measurement range provides broad compatibility across a spectrum of low-voltage DC systems. A key protective feature highlighted in the comparative imagery is its reverse connection protection. This safeguard is critical for preventing damage to the device and potentially the connected circuit. It protects against common mistakes.

This wide voltage range ensures the voltmeter is suitable for diverse applications, encompassing standard 12V and 24V automotive systems, 48V battery banks, and even higher-voltage industrial DC setups. The integrated reverse polarity protection is a significant advantage, enhancing the device's overall reliability and reducing the likelihood of costly user errors during installation or maintenance.
